Always display infographic in interactive mode
What is interactive mode infographic?

The infographic you see by default is an image. On the interactive infographic, you can mouseover, click, tap etc. on the chart to see more details about the fights. The browser's localStorage will be used to store your preference.

Tomás Rojas Record

Total Fights74
Title Wins1
Title Defenses2
Title-Fight KOs1
KO Wins34
KO Losses5
Tomás Rojas Record & Stats
Tomás Rojas' Record
Tomás Rojas' boxing record and career infographic

      Featured Opponents

      What is Tomás Rojas' boxing record?

      25 years and two months into his professional boxing career, Tomás Rojas has fought 74 times with 52 wins, 20 losses, and 1 draw.

      Rojas' boxing record is currently 52-20-1, which includes one super-flyweight world-title win and two successful title defense fights. He has a 46.6% knockouts-to-fights ratio with 34 of his total 74 fights being knockout wins, one of which was in a title fight. Rojas has suffered five knockout losses in his career, two of which were in title fights.

      His last fight was a 5th round TKO defeat to Moussa Gholam on February 27, 2022. He is on a one-fight losing streak.

      Some of Rojas' best fights and notable victories include wins over Jhonny González, Kohei Kono, Juan José Montes, Nobuo Nashiro, Isaac Bustos, Jairo Lopez, and Dario Azuaga.

      74Feb 27, 202241Moussa GholamLossTKO5
      73Dec 17, 202040Ranfis EncarnaciónWinDQ
      72Mar 7, 202039Muhammadkhuja YaqubovLossUD
      71Sep 7, 201939Miguel RománLossUD
      70Jun 22, 201939Andrés GutiérrezLossUD
      69Feb 2, 201938Jairo LopezWinRTD10
      68Oct 6, 201838Jhonny GonzálezWinMD
      67Oct 7, 201737Edivaldo OrtegaLossRTD7
      66Jun 17, 201737Jose CifuentesWinTKO5
      65Apr 8, 201736Cristian MijaresLossUD
      64Aug 13, 201636Jose SanmartinWinDQ
      63Apr 9, 201635Prosper AnkrahWinRTD4
      62Oct 17, 201535Edward MansitoWinTKO9
      61May 30, 201534Jonathan Lecona RamosWinKO5
      60Aug 9, 201434Irving BerryWinUD
      59May 3, 201433Jose CabreraWinTKO8
      58Jan 11, 201433Vergel NebranWinTKO8
      57Sep 7, 201333Enrique BernacheWinUD
      56Apr 13, 201332Jaderes PaduaWinKO6
      55Nov 3, 201232Shinsuke YamanakaLoss *KO7
      54Jul 14, 201232Manuel de los Reyes HerreraWinKO4
      53Mar 3, 201231Julio ZarateWinUD
      52Nov 5, 201131Dario AzuagaWinTKO2
      51Aug 19, 201131Suriyan Sor RungvisaiLoss *UD
      50May 21, 201130Juan José MontesWin *RTD11
      49Feb 5, 201130Nobuo NashiroWin *UD
      48Sep 20, 201030Kohei KonoWin *UD
      47Jun 19, 201030Felipe AlmanzaWinRTD6
      46May 1, 201029Jorge CardenasWinTKO4
      45Dec 12, 200929Vic DarchinyanLoss *KO2
      44Oct 24, 200929Evans MbambaWinUD
      43Jul 18, 200929Everardo MoralesWinRTD9
      42Mar 28, 200928Javier RomanoWinKO6
      41Jan 17, 200928Carlos RuedaWinRTD9
      40Dec 6, 200828Cesar Ricardo MartinezDrawTD
      39Jul 19, 200828Charly ValenzuelaWinKO3
      38Nov 24, 200727Marco Antonio HernandezWinUD
      37Sep 16, 200727Jorge ArceLossTKO6
      36Aug 10, 200727Jorge LopezWinTKO5
      35Jun 2, 200726Anselmo MorenoLossUD
      34Apr 22, 200726Jorge RomeroWinTKO2
      33Feb 3, 200726Julio GrimaldoWinKO4
      32Oct 26, 200626Ramon LeyteWinTKO7
      31Jul 2, 200626Gerry PeñalosaLossUD
      30Apr 22, 200625Jose NievesLossUD
      29Oct 29, 200525Luis MaldonadoLossSD
      28Feb 26, 200524Erick SandovalWinTKO9
      27Sep 17, 200424Moises CastroWinTKO10
      26Mar 12, 200423Cristian MijaresLossUD
      25Sep 27, 200323Jacinto QuintanaWinUD
      24Jul 25, 200323Francisco ParedesWinKO3
      23Sep 14, 200222Javier TorresWinKO6
      22May 17, 200221Alejandro MontielNCNC
      21Sep 1, 200121Trinidad MendozaWinTKO8
      20Apr 8, 200120Javier TorresWinUD
      19Sep 29, 200020Ruben DiazWinUD
      18Mar 11, 200019Rosendo ÁlvarezLossUD
      17Nov 18, 199919Rolando DiazWinKO11
      16Jul 4, 199919Lauro LopezLossSD
      15Jun 5, 199918Jesus MartinezLossUD
      14Apr 29, 199918Orlando RojasWinUD
      13Mar 20, 199918Cecilio SantosLossMD
      12Oct 24, 199818Isaac BustosWinTKO3
      11Jul 16, 199818Guillermo FuentesWinKO8
      10May 29, 199817Gonzalo Diaz MontalvoWinUD
      9May 9, 199817Aldo AmaroWinTKO1
      8Feb 7, 199817Aaron DominguezLossSD
      7Nov 18, 199717Javier AlonsoWinKO6
      6Sep 20, 199717Juan GuerreroWinKO6
      5Aug 11, 199717Jorge SantosWinKO3
      4Jul 13, 199717Gustavo MoralesWinKO5
      3May 2, 199716Agustin HernandezWinUD
      2Jan 15, 199716David SanchezWinUD
      1Dec 16, 199616Gonzalo Diaz MontalvoWinUD

      * World-title fight

      Boxing career

      Tomás Rojas (Gusano) is a 44-year old Mexican professional boxer. He was born in Tlalixcoyan, Veracruz, Mexico on June 12, 1980. He is a former super-flyweight world champion.

      Rojas made his professional boxing debut against Gonzalo Diaz Montalvo at the age of 16 on December 16, 1996, defeating Montalvo via 4 round unanimous decision. He went on to win 6 more consecutive fights after the debut, which included 4 wins via stoppage.

      He had his first world title fight at the age of 29 on December 12, 2009 after 44 professional fights, against Vic Darchinyan for the WBC title. He lost to Darchinyan via 2nd round KO.

      Rojas has won one world title at super-flyweight. For all the details about Rojas' world title wins and defenses refer to the "Championships" section below.

      Rojas has had a total of 20 losses in his professional boxing career so far.

      His most recent fight was a non-title bout against Moussa Gholam on February 27, 2022. Rojas lost the fight via 5th round TKO. It's been 2 years, 3 months, and 27 days since this fight.


      Rojas has had a total of six world-title fights till today, which includes winning one world title and two successful title defenses. He won three of these fights and lost three.

      Title Wins

      Tomás Rojas has fought for a super-flyweight world title in three fights and won once. Till today, he has won one super-flyweight belt.

      DateOpponentDivisionTitles WonMethod
      Sep 20, 2010Kohei KonoSuper-flyweightWBC*UD
      * Vacant title

      Title Defenses

      Tomás Rojas has had three super-flyweight world-title defense fights. He won two of them and lost once.

      Following is the table of his successful title defense fights, the next section has the fights where he lost his titles.

      DateOpponentDivisionTitles DefendedMethod
      May 21, 2011Juan José MontesSuper-flyweightWBCRTD
      Feb 5, 2011Nobuo NashiroSuper-flyweightWBCUD

      Title Losses

      Tomás Rojas has lost one world-title defense fight, and lost one title in the fight.

      DateOpponentDivisionTitles LostMethod
      Aug 19, 2011Suriyan Sor RungvisaiSuper-flyweightWBCUD


      Ape Index
      Win Streak
      Career Score